## Runbook: Canary Gating Rules

For the weekly sync: Driftgate canaries promote automatically only when error rate stays under 0.5% and p95 latency within 10% of baseline for 30 minutes. Any manual override must be logged in the gating table with a reason. Rollbacks reset the observation window. Gate decisions and override history are stored in the deploy-metrics database; query it using the connection string below.

primary connection of hadup-kajeg = clickhouse://rusath_svc:lTa6pgZ@db-a477.plorvaforge.corp:5432/oliox

## PR: Tighten pick-list optimizer bounds

This change constrains the route solver in the Dockhand optimizer so untrusted pick-list inputs cannot trigger unbounded memory growth. All limits are enforced before parsing, and oversize requests are rejected with an audit log entry. No secrets or credentials are touched. The enforced limits are defined as constants here.

constants for fajep-kawig:
QUOTAS = {
    "belath": 89,
    "tamdor": 722,
}

Finance Review — Marlow & Pitt Pilot

Quick summary for the sales leads: the pilot with the Marlow & Pitt retail chain closed the quarter slightly ahead of forecast, with sell-through beating our model by about eight percent in the Tarn Valley stores. Setup costs ran a bit hot, mostly signage and training. Margins look workable if we renegotiate logistics. Overall, a cautious thumbs-up. The bigger picture on where this goes next is right below.

board note of kagep-yahig: Only 9 of the 120 pilot accounts renewed Quenix, so a churn review is set for April 1.